Music News 2.22.12
Just when you thought everyone in America bought Adele's 21 CD, she goes and has her best sales week ever! Thanks to her six Grammy awards last weekend, Adele sold 730,000 albums this week. Which coincidentally happens to be her 21st week at #1. That is the longest a female artist has ever been at #1 on the Album Chart with one CD, breaking the old record of 20 weeks held by Whitney Houston's The Bodyguard Soundtrack.

Music News! 2.21.12
It was another big night for Adele tonight at the Brit Awards across the pond.  She won 2 awards at the UK version of the Grammys tonight, but it was not a sweep for her like it was last weekend at our Grammys.  She won Best British Female and Album Of The Year, but did not win British Single.  That award went to boy band One Direction and their song "What Makes You Beautiful."  One Direction has had a huge 2011 in the UK, and will attempt to recreate their success here in the US this year.  If you want to hear the song that beat out Adele, I've got it up on the Hot New Music Page.

Other winners at the Brit Awards included Rihanna for International Female, Bruno Mars for International Male, and Coldplay for British Group.  Lana Del Rey, taking some flack here in the US for her awkward Saturday Night Live appearance last month, won International Breakthrough Act (Best New Artist).
